Key Features of AI Reservation Systems

The core capabilities of AI reservation systems lie in their ability to intelligently manage the booking and seating process. At the heart of these systems are advanced algorithms that can predict and manage dining duration, ensuring a seamless flow of customers and minimizing disruptions to overall table management.

One of the key features of AI reservation systems is their integration capabilities with other digital management tools, such as point-of-sale (POS) systems and customer relationship management (CRM) software. By synchronizing with these systems, AI reservation platforms can provide real-time updates on table status, availability, and customer preferences, enabling restaurants to make more informed decisions about seating arrangements.

Moreover, these AI-powered systems offer dynamic adjustments to booking availability based on the real-time dining flow. As customers arrive and depart, the system can automatically update table statuses, allowing restaurants to optimize seating arrangements and maximize their overall capacity.

One increasingly popular feature of AI reservation systems is the integration of a restaurant AI phone answering system. These systems leverage natural language processing and machine learning to provide automated, personalized assistance to customers calling to make reservations. By handling routine inquiries and bookings, the AI phone system can help free up staff to focus on other important tasks, such as providing exceptional in-person service.

The AI phone answering system can quickly gather relevant customer information, suggest available reservation times based on real-time table availability, and even reschedule or cancel bookings as needed. This integration with the overall reservation management platform ensures a seamless experience for both customers and restaurant staff.

Challenges and Considerations in Implementing AI Systems

While the benefits of AI reservation systems are clear, the implementation of these technologies is not without its challenges. Restaurant owners must carefully consider the technical, financial, and customer-centric implications before investing in such systems.

Technical Challenges Related to Integration with Existing Systems

Integrating AI reservation systems with a restaurant’s existing POS, CRM, and other digital management tools can pose technical hurdles. Ensuring a seamless flow of data and harmonious operation between these systems requires careful planning and collaboration with technology providers.

Cost Implications and ROI from Adopting AI Reservation Systems

The adoption of AI reservation systems often comes with significant upfront and ongoing costs, including software licensing fees, hardware upgrades, and staff training. Restaurant owners must carefully evaluate the potential return on investment (ROI) to justify the financial investment in these technologies.

Managing Customer Expectations and Privacy Concerns in AI Interactions

As AI systems become more prevalent in the restaurant industry, managing customer expectations and addressing privacy concerns are crucial. Restaurants must strike a balance between leveraging the benefits of AI-powered systems and maintaining transparency and trust with their patrons.

Frequently Asked Questions

What makes AI reservation systems different from traditional reservation software?

AI reservation systems are powered by advanced algorithms and predictive analytics, which enable them to forecast dining durations, optimize table allocations, and dynamically adjust booking availability based on real-time data. Traditional reservation software, on the other hand, typically relies on static scheduling and lacks the adaptive capabilities of AI-powered systems.

How do AI reservation systems handle unexpected changes in restaurant capacity or customer no-shows?

AI reservation systems are designed to be highly responsive to real-time changes in restaurant capacity and customer behavior. By continuously monitoring the dining flow and updating table statuses, these systems can quickly adjust booking availability and seating arrangements to accommodate unexpected challenges, such as customer no-shows or sudden changes in demand.

Are there privacy concerns with collecting customer data through AI systems?

Yes, there are valid concerns regarding customer data privacy when implementing AI reservation systems. Restaurants must ensure that they have robust data security measures in place and comply with relevant privacy regulations, such as the General Data Protection Regulation (GDPR) or the California Consumer Privacy Act (CCPA). Transparent communication with customers about data collection and usage policies is crucial to maintaining trust and addressing any privacy concerns.
